Embodiment

[0021] The invention is a fast food restaurant ordering system based on a wireless network, comprising an intelligent desktop ordering machine; wireless WiFi for data transmission; a system host controller; a front desk server; a front desk display and printing device; a kitchen server; a kitchen menu Real-time display device; voice prompt device after menu creation; logistics cleaning table server; logistics cleaning table display device.

[0022] Further, the intelligent desktop ordering machine is connected to the system host controller through the WiFi wireless network, and the front desk server, the kitchen server, and the logistics cleaning table server are all connected to the system host controller, and the three servers are respectively connected to the front desk display device and the kitchen menu. Abstract

The invention discloses a fast food restaurant meal ordering system based on a wireless network. The system comprises an intelligent desktop meal ordering machine; wireless WiFi which is used for performing data transmission; a system host controller; a foreground server; a foreground display and printing device; a kitchen server; a kitchen menu real-time display device; a menu making completion voice prompting device; a logistic dining table cleaning server; and logistic dining table cleaning display equipment. The foreground server, the kitchen server and the logistic dining table cleaning server are connected with the system host controller. The intelligent desktop meal ordering machine can dynamically display meal image information, meal number, price, set meals, membership and other information and also has a self-service settling function, and the foreground host can receive settlement information of the specific table number after settlement so that settlement of a fast food restaurant is facilitated. According to the fast food restaurant meal ordering system based on the wireless network, certain disadvantages of the manual service can be overcome so that the working efficiency of the fast food restaurant can be greatly enhanced and the cost can be saved.
